location of External Ambient Air Temp Sensor
 
Does anyone know where the external ambient air temp sensor is located on a 1990 E30 325i. I want to replace it myself but want to be sure it is easy to get to before I order the part.

Thanks!

Jared at Pelican Parts 05-21-2004 08:08 AM

If you are refeering to the sensor for ther outside air temp, it is located in the driver's side brake duct in the front of the car

bimmer1990325i 05-21-2004 08:28 AM

Can I see it and get to it without the car being on a lift....meaning, laying on the ground?

Jared at Pelican Parts 05-21-2004 08:30 AM

Should be able to. Look from the front of the car throguh the driver's brake duct. You'll need to remove the duct from the car in order to change the sensor. The duct should just pop out...
